Read this record carefully.

The citation files cover the three most recent standard inspections plus qualifying complaint and infection-control inspections in the prior three years. A correction date is a CMS field; this site does not independently verify conditions. Absence from a file is not proof that no issue exists.

BEFORE A CARE DECISION

Verify the current record and visit in person.

Use this ledger to frame questions—not to choose care on its own. Recheck Medicare Care Compare, contact the state survey agency and long-term care ombudsman, and ask the facility about anything you find.
